RuleWay #
RuleWay is a lightweight embeddable rule engine for Dart applications, device automation, and edge Linux devices. It is designed for workloads where rules are driven by device attributes, attribute changes, rule-level time windows, and explicit action handlers.

postAttrUpdate() and tick() return futures because registered actions may be
asynchronous. Await them when deterministic action completion is required.
Event Context and Actions #
Attach request, session, or source metadata to an attribute update without storing it as device state:
engine.registerAction('notify', (action, context) async {
final requestId = context.context['request_id'];
await sendNotification(requestId, action.params);
});
await engine.postAttrUpdate(
'AC01',
{'temperature': 31},
context: {'request_id': 'req-42'},
);
For rules with duration > 0, RuleWay preserves the context from the event that
started the duration window. Calling tick() continues evaluating eligible
duration rules even when no new attribute event arrives. attr_change rules
still require a new edge event and are not completed by a timer tick.

week_repeat uses 0..6 for Monday..Sunday. Empty or missing means every day.
time_windows is optional; if omitted, the rule is always active.
All time_windows, time, date in_weekday, and cron calculations use the
timezone passed to RuleEngine(timeZone: ...); they never use the host machine's
local timezone.
device_actions is optional and runs after global actions.
